Can I take a ferry from Kos (Main Port) to Panormitis, Symi?
Yes, ferries run between Kos (Main Port) and Panormitis, Symi. This route is operated by Dodekanisos Seaways, and takes around 1h 20min on average. Ferries are available seasonally.

Are cars allowed on the ferries from Kos (Main Port) to Panormitis, Symi?
Cars are not allowed on ferries operating between Kos (Main Port) and Panormitis, Symi. This route is exclusively for foot passengers.

Can I bring my pet on board?
Yes, pets are allowed on ferries from Kos (Main Port) to Panormitis, Symi, but specific policies vary by ferry company. General guidelines:
- Pets over 10 kg must be kept in the ship’s onboard kennels; pets under 10 kg can stay in their owner’s pet carrier.
- Service dogs are exempt from kennel requirements.
- Ensure you have all the necessary documents, tickets, and pet essentials for your trip.
- Greek operators typically allow pets for free.

Exploring Panormitis, Symi
Panormitis, a charming village on the island of Symi, is a fantastic place to visit! One of its most special features is the stunning Panormitis Monastery. This big, beautiful church has amazing paintings and a peaceful garden where you can take a break and enjoy the views. The beach nearby is perfect for a swim, with crystal-clear water and soft sand to relax on.
In Panormitis, you can try delicious local foods like fresh seafood and sweet pastries. Don’t forget to taste the local honey—it's so yummy! For fun, you can hike the nearby trails that lead to breathtaking spots where you can see the ocean and colorful houses dotted along the hills.
Panormitis is great for a short visit, but it’s also a great starting point to explore other nearby places like Symi Town or hop on a boat to different islands. Whether you want to relax on the beach or dive into history, Panormitis has something special for everyone!
